1. Personalized Teacher Back to School Gifts
Personalized gifts add a special touch and show that you put thought into the present. These customized items can become cherished keepsakes for teachers to remember their students by.
1.1. Engraved Stationery & Desk Accessories
- Personalized Pen: A quality pen engraved with the teacher’s name or a heartfelt message is a classic and practical gift.
- Custom Nameplate: A stylish nameplate for their desk adds a professional and personalized touch to their workspace.
- Engraved Notebook or Journal: A beautiful notebook or journal with their name or initials is perfect for jotting down lesson plans, notes, or reflections.
- Monogrammed Desk Organizer: Help them keep their desk tidy with a personalized organizer for pens, pencils, and other supplies.
1.2. Custom-Made Classroom Decor
- Personalized Classroom Sign: A custom-made sign with the teacher’s name and subject adds a welcoming touch to their classroom. Consider incorporating their favorite quote or inspirational message.
- Student-Designed Artwork: Encourage students to create individual artwork pieces that can be combined into a larger, framed piece for the teacher.
- Custom-Made Tote Bag: A personalized tote bag with the teacher’s name or a fun school-related design is perfect for carrying books, papers, and other essentials.
1.3. Personalized Gifts for Different Subjects
Tailor the personalized gift to the teacher’s subject for an extra special touch. A history teacher might appreciate a vintage map with their name on it, while a science teacher could enjoy a personalized beaker or lab coat.
2. Practical Teacher Back to School Gifts
Practical gifts are always appreciated by teachers, as they can use them in their daily classroom activities or to simplify their workload.
2.1. Classroom Supplies & Organization Tools
- High-Quality Markers and Pens: Teachers always need a fresh supply of markers and pens for grading papers, writing on the board, and creating engaging lesson materials.
- Classroom Organization Bins and Containers: Help them keep their classroom clutter-free with colorful bins and containers for storing supplies and student work.
- Bulletin Board Supplies: Provide them with fun and engaging bulletin board materials, such as borders, letters, and cutouts, to create interactive displays.
- Digital Classroom Tools: Gift cards for educational apps or subscriptions to online learning platforms can enhance their teaching resources.
2.2. Teacher Comfort & Well-being
- Comfortable Desk Chair Cushion: A comfortable chair cushion can make a big difference in their daily comfort, especially during long hours of sitting.
- Travel Mug or Water Bottle: A stylish and insulated travel mug or water bottle keeps their drinks at the perfect temperature throughout the day.
- Stress-Relief Items: Consider a small aromatherapy diffuser, stress ball, or hand lotion to help them unwind after a busy day.
2.3. Tech Gadgets for the Classroom
- Portable Bluetooth Speaker: A portable speaker allows them to play music during class activities or use audio resources for lessons.
- Wireless Headphones: Noise-canceling headphones can be a lifesaver for grading papers or preparing lessons in a noisy environment.
- Digital Pen: A digital pen can help them digitize their notes and lesson plans, making them easily accessible and shareable.
3. Teacher Back to School Gifts by Occasion
Different occasions call for different types of gifts. Consider the specific event when choosing a present for a teacher.
3.1. First Day of School Gifts
- Welcome Back Kit: A small basket filled with essential classroom supplies, a personalized note, and a small treat is a perfect way to welcome them back to school.
- Gift Card to a Local Coffee Shop: Help them start their day with a caffeine boost by gifting a gift card to their favorite coffee shop.
- Small Plant for Their Desk: A small, low-maintenance plant adds a touch of greenery to their classroom and can brighten their day.
3.2. Teacher Appreciation Week Gifts
- Handmade Cards and Gifts from Students: Encourage students to create personalized cards or small gifts to show their appreciation for their teacher.
- Class Gift from Parents: Parents can pool their resources to purchase a larger gift, such as a new classroom rug, a set of books, or a gift certificate to a local restaurant.
- Volunteer Time in the Classroom: Offer to volunteer in the classroom to assist with tasks or activities, giving the teacher some much-needed extra help.
3.3. End-of-Year Gifts
- Personalized Yearbook or Photo Album: A yearbook or photo album filled with pictures of the class and memories from the year is a treasured keepsake.
- Gift Card for Summer Fun: Help them enjoy their summer break with a gift card to a local spa, bookstore, or movie theater.
- Thank You Note Expressing Gratitude: A heartfelt thank you note from students and parents expressing their gratitude for the teacher’s dedication is a simple yet meaningful gift.
4. Teacher Back to School Gifts by Budget
Finding the perfect gift doesn’t have to break the bank. There are plenty of thoughtful and affordable options available.
4.1. Gifts Under $10
- Handmade Bookmarks: Students can create personalized bookmarks for their teacher using craft supplies.
- Decorative Desk Tape: Add some personality to their desk with colorful and patterned decorative tape.
- Gourmet Candy or Snacks: A small bag of their favorite candy or snacks is a simple and affordable treat.
4.2. Gifts Under $25
- Gift Set of Scented Candles or Soaps: A relaxing gift set of scented candles or soaps can help them unwind after a long day.
- Personalized Water Bottle or Coffee Mug: A personalized water bottle or coffee mug is a practical and stylish gift.
- Set of Colorful Gel Pens: A set of colorful gel pens is a fun and practical gift for grading papers and creating engaging lesson materials.
4.3. Gifts Under $50
- Gift Basket Filled with Classroom Supplies: A gift basket filled with essential classroom supplies, such as markers, pens, and sticky notes, is a practical and thoughtful gift.
- Gift Certificate to a Local Restaurant or Bookstore: A gift certificate to a local restaurant or bookstore allows them to choose something they truly enjoy.
- Personalized Tote Bag or Laptop Sleeve: A personalized tote bag or laptop sleeve is a stylish and practical gift for carrying their belongings.
5. DIY Teacher Back to School Gifts
DIY gifts are a great way to show your creativity and personalize a present for your teacher.
5.1. Student-Created Artwork and Crafts
- Hand-Painted Flower Pots: Students can decorate flower pots and plant small herbs or flowers for their teacher’s desk.
- Decorated Picture Frames: Students can decorate picture frames and insert a class photo or a drawing of their teacher.
- Handmade Cards with Personalized Messages: Encourage students to write heartfelt messages of appreciation in handmade cards.
5.2. Baked Goods and Treats
- Homemade Cookies or Brownies: Bake a batch of their favorite cookies or brownies and package them in a decorative container.
- Fruit and Cheese Platter: A colorful fruit and cheese platter is a healthy and refreshing treat.
- Personalized Candy Jar: Fill a jar with their favorite candies and decorate it with a personalized label.
5.3. Classroom Decor Crafts
- DIY Pencil Holders: Create unique pencil holders using recycled materials, such as tin cans or plastic bottles.
- Handmade Bulletin Board Decorations: Students can create colorful and engaging bulletin board decorations using craft supplies.
- DIY Classroom Organization Bins: Decorate plain storage bins with paint, fabric, or paper to create personalized classroom organizers.
FAQ: Teacher Back to School Gift Ideas
-
What are some good back-to-school gifts for a new teacher? A welcome kit with basic supplies, a gift card for coffee, or a small plant for their desk are great options.
-
What are some unique teacher gift ideas? Personalized gifts, experience gifts (like tickets to a show), or donations to a charity in their name are unique options.
-
What are some inexpensive teacher gift ideas? Handmade cards, DIY crafts, or baked goods are thoughtful and budget-friendly choices.
-
What are some appropriate gifts for male teachers? Practical gifts like tech gadgets, gift cards to hardware stores, or personalized stationery are suitable options.
-
Should I give a gift to every teacher my child has? It’s a kind gesture but not mandatory. Focus on teachers your child connects with or who have made a significant impact.
-
When is the best time to give a back-to-school teacher gift? The first week of school or during Teacher Appreciation Week are ideal times.
-
Are gift cards appropriate for teacher gifts? Yes, gift cards to coffee shops, bookstores, or restaurants are generally appreciated.
-
What should I avoid gifting a teacher? Avoid overly personal gifts, gag gifts, or anything that could be perceived as inappropriate or offensive.
